背景信息

The CDH16 antibody targets cadherin-16 (CDH16), a calcium-dependent cell adhesion protein belonging to the cadherin superfamily. CDH16. also known as kidney-specific cadherin (KSP-cadherin) or human hepatocarcinoma-intestine-pancreas/pancreatitis-associated protein (HIP/PAP), is primarily expressed in the kidney, specifically in proximal tubule epithelial cells, and in the thyroid gland. It plays a critical role in maintaining tissue architecture by mediating cell-cell adhesion and polarity. CDH16's restricted expression makes it a valuable biomarker for studying kidney and thyroid development, function, and associated pathologies.

In research, CDH16 antibodies are widely used to identify and characterize renal proximal tubular cells in immunohistochemistry, flow cytometry, and Western blotting. They also aid in distinguishing kidney-derived tumors (e.g., renal cell carcinomas) from other malignancies due to CDH16's tissue specificity. Additionally, CDH16 has been implicated in developmental studies, as its expression correlates with nephron formation and renal epithelial differentiation. Dysregulation of CDH16 is associated with kidney diseases and thyroid disorders, though its exact mechanistic roles remain under investigation.

Structurally, CDH16 contains characteristic cadherin repeats and a conserved cytoplasmic domain that interacts with catenins, linking it to the cytoskeleton. The antibody’s utility in both basic and clinical research underscores its importance in understanding cellular adhesion mechanisms and tissue-specific pathologies.
